the bonus depends on your store/district (at mine it’s $60 per trainee) but you have got to be a SUPER patient person, every person learns at a different speed. i’ve had trainees pick things up relatively quickly (obviously they aren’t gonna know everything right away) but others it was just having to constantly explain the same thing over and over and over again.
it’s really nice to not have to really talk to customers (except when training on register or drive thru) and just focus on training but it is also super exhausting, i’ll train someone for 4 hours and feel like i’ve worked 20 hours straight.
it also looks good when applying for SSV! i recently just got promoted to SSV
